Step 3: Navigate to DDPAI Video Files

  1. Open File Explorer (Windows) or Finder (Mac)
  2. Locate your SD card drive (usually labeled "DDPAI" or "NO NAME")
  3. Navigate to folder structure:
    • Normal folder: Continuous loop recordings (1-3 minute segments)
    • Event folder: G-sensor triggered incident recordings
    • Photo folder: Still images (if photo mode enabled)
    • Parking folder: Parking mode recordings (if enabled)

DDPAI file naming: Files follow format like 20260528_093045_N.mp4 (YYYYMMDD_HHMMSS_type)

  • _N = Normal recording
  • _E = Event recording
  • _P = Parking mode

Step 4: Copy Files to Computer

  1. Select videos you need (Ctrl/Cmd+Click for multiple files)
  2. Copy (Ctrl+C on Windows / Cmd+C on Mac)
  3. Navigate to destination folder (Desktop, Documents, Videos)
  4. Paste (Ctrl+V on Windows / Cmd+V on Mac)
  5. Wait for transfer (typical speed: 20-80 MB/s depending on card quality)

DDPAI file sizes (approximate):

  • 1600p (Mini 3): ~250MB per minute
  • 2K (N5): ~300MB per minute
  • 4K (Z50, Mini 5): ~450-500MB per minute

Transfer time example: 30 minutes of 4K footage (~15GB) takes 5-10 minutes via SD card reader.

Troubleshooting DDPAI Download Issues: Middle East Solutions

"SD Card Not Recognized" (Common in UAE Heat)

Solutions:

  • Let SD card cool: If removed from hot dashcam in UAE summer, wait 2-3 minutes before inserting into computer
  • Try different USB port or reader: Heat can temporarily affect contacts
  • Check SD card lock switch: Small switch on side of SD adapter—ensure it's unlocked
  • Test in dashcam: Verify card works and shows recordings on DDPAI screen
  • Format card in DDPAI: Settings → Format (WARNING: deletes all content)
  • Replace if corrupted: UAE heat degrades SD cards faster—replace every 12 months

Heat damage prevention: Store spare SD cards in air-conditioned environments, not in hot car glove compartments.

"DDPAI App Won't Connect" (WiFi Issues in Middle East)

Solutions:

  • Verify WiFi enabled: Check DDPAI screen shows WiFi icon or blue LED
  • Confirm phone connection: Ensure connected to "DDPAI-####" network, NOT home WiFi (Etisalat/du/STC)
  • Move closer: WiFi range reduced in hot metal car interiors—stand within 5 meters
  • Restart both devices: Turn off DDPAI and restart phone WiFi
  • Check for interference: Dubai/Riyadh high-rise buildings can cause WiFi interference—move car to open area
  • Update DDPAI app: Ensure latest version from App Store/Play Store
  • Heat impact: In 45°C+ weather, let car cool with AC before attempting WiFi connection

"Videos Won't Play on Computer" (Format/Codec Issues)

Solutions:

  • Use VLC Media Player: Free, supports all DDPAI formats (Download from VideoLAN.org)
  • Install K-Lite Codec Pack: Enables Windows Media Player support for H.264/H.265
  • Check file isn't corrupted: If removed SD card during recording, file may be damaged
  • Verify file extension: DDPAI uses .mp4 format—if showing .tmp or .dat, file is incomplete
  • Don't interrupt recording: Always let DDPAI finish current segment before removing power

UAE-specific: Heat corruption more common in summer. Monthly SD card formatting recommended.

"Downloaded Video Has No GPS Data or Speed" (Metadata Loss)

Solutions:

  • Enable GPS in DDPAI settings: Menu → GPS → ON
  • Wait for GPS lock: First 30-60 seconds after starting car may have no GPS (normal)
  • Use DDPAI Player software: Download from DDPAI website to view embedded GPS/speed data
  • Check video player: VLC and QuickTime support GPS metadata; Windows Media Player may not
  • Avoid re-encoding: If you edit video, ensure "Preserve metadata" option enabled

Middle East GPS accuracy: Generally excellent in open areas (Dubai highways, desert roads). May be slower in downtown Riyadh/Dubai high-rise areas or underground parking.
